Amazon Leo is Amazon’s low Earth orbit satellite broadband network. Its mission is to deliver fast, reliable internet to customers and communities around the world, providing the capacity, flexibility, and performance needed by households, schools, hospitals, businesses, government agencies, and other organizations in underserved locations.

Key Job Responsibilities

Defining enterprise systems—extended warehouse management (EWM) strategy, developing system requirements, designing and prototyping, testing, training, defining support procedures, and implementing practical business solutions under multiple deadlines.

Analyze new business requirements and changes to existing functionalities (large and extra-large projects).

Lead and drive upcoming projects related to EWM.

Provide support to end users on all EWM‑related activities, including inventory management.

Serve as the focal point for production support tickets related to EWM and inventory management.

Lead enhancement projects related to Radio Frequency functionalities in EWM.

Collaborate with cross‑functional teams to drive projects to completion.

Provide design and testing support for all EWM related developments such as enhancements, user exits, custom reports, and new features.

Support a multi‑plant and multi‑warehouse discrete manufacturing environment that is fast‑paced.

Ensure KPI and SLAs are achieved and monitored.

Maintain and support SAP solutions.

A day in the life: You will collaborate with enterprise architects, business leadership, and other stakeholders to develop SAP Extended Warehouse Management solutions to meet the dynamic demands of internal customers in manufacturing. Your primary role is to work with developers and consulting partners to solve problems and drive projects to completion, liaising between various Leo business units to provide technology and process‑driven solutions that improve the efficiency of Leo’s Warehouse Management and Factory fulfillment processes.

Basic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ree.

Experience owning/driving roadmap strategy and definition.

Experience representing and advocating for a variety of critical customers and stakeholders during executive‑level prioritization and planning.

Minimum of 5 years of hands‑on SAP configuration experience within the Extended Warehouse Management (EWM).

Configuration in the SAP EWM module with a minimum of 2 full end‑to‑end implementations preferably in a discrete manufacturing environment.

Experience in Quality Inspection, Configuring Physical Inventory, Configure Slotting and Rearrangement Post‑processing framework, Output configuration of Master Data & Warehouse Structure Creation and Dock.

Experience in direct goods receipt, goods issue process via stock transfer orders, put‑away and picking strategies, Kitting.

Understand the inter‑dependencies of the SAP PP, QM, and EWM modules, including master data and transactional objects.

Strong exposure with enabling handheld (mobile data entry) functionalities.

Good exposure in Handling Unit / Batch Management processes.

Ability to author Functional Specifications related to EWM and inventory management.

Excellent communication skills.

Ability to train and interact effectively with end users.

Preferred Qualifications

Experience building and driving adoption of new tools.

Master’s degree in IT, Supply Chain or related field of study.

10+ years of hands‑on experience in Warehouse Projects within Manufacturing Operations using SAP EWM/WM.

Knowledge of SAP MM, PP, or QM modules.

Experience working in Aerospace/Defense industries and in ITAR environments.

Experience using ABAP / Quickviewer to create queries.
